Identification title(s): portrait of william iii, prince of orange. Object type: print object number: rp-p-ob-104. 463. Catalog reference: van someren 318. Inscriptions / marks: collector's mark, verso lower left, stamped: lugt 963. Description: portrait of william iii in an octagonal frame. In the middle below his coat of arms with a crown. In the bottom margin are name and titles. Manufacture. Manufacturer: printmaker: anonymous, publisher: theodor van merlen (ii) (mentioned on object). Place of manufacture: printmaker: netherlands, publisher: antwerp. Dating: 1660 - 1672. Physical features: engraving and etching. Material: paper technique: engraving (printing process) / etching. Dimensions: plate edge: h 165 mm × w 118 mm explanation the title stated here refers to the highest title obtained by the sitter, not necessarily to the title that the sitter bears in this performance. Subject. Who: william iii (prince of orange and king of england, scotland and ireland). Credit line: donation from mr d. Franken, le vésinet. Acquisition: donation 1871. Date: between 1660 and 1672.
